Job description
What your impact will be:
  • Supervise a team of care managers who provide chronic care management services on behalf of our client’s patients.
  • Assist with creating and maintaining training materials, process documentation, client protocols, and standard operating procedures.
  • Provide training and education to care management team.
  • Track team production and provide regular feedback including monthly and quarterly touchpoints.
  • Audit care management documentation and phone calls for quality assurance.
  • Set up and administer login accounts for care managers to various systems (electronic health records, phone system, and other third-party software solutions)
  • Strive for constant operational improvement via workflow analysis and feedback from clients, patients, and team members.
  • Assist with content for team building events, marketing materials, and patient education as needed.
  • Communicate with clients regularly and conduct strategic account reviews with clients monthly.
  • Manage key operational efficiency projects.
  • Maintain knowledge of - competitors offerings and industry trends.
  • Assist with implementation of new software solutions, reporting tools, and client integrations.
  • Collaborate on a myriad of projects across the spectrum of virtual and remote healthcare.
  • Provide coverage for care management staff as needed
